Asphalt Gods Enrico natali English illustrator Arthur Rackham (1867-1939)First edition of Asphalt Gods by Gabriel Griffin (2010). Small format softcover in fine condition. Title page signed by the artist and numbered 829 1000. Please see photos for reference. About Compiled by filmmaker Gabriel Griffin in 2010 from the archives of the Venice and South Bay chapters of the notorious "Heathens MF" motorcycle gang, "Asphalt Gods" documents "the end of the golden age of outlaw motorcycling" in Southern California.
